Apart from being a somewhat impractical methodology of doing enterprise, this is not what “no-limit” betting is about in any respect. You can not push someone out of a pot just because your ranch and/or livestock are value more than theirs. In actuality, no-limit hold’em is played “table stakes.” The quantity of chips in entrance of you on the desk at the start of the hand is the utmost you presumably can wager.https://holymolykazino.lv/casino/boho-casino-review

So even when you’re not “planning” on risking a quantity of buy-ins upon sitting down at a recreation, the potential for being confronted with a call to “call” all of your chips off in any given hand nonetheless exists – always. Once the Small Blind and Big Blind gamers have “posted” their corresponding blinds, each player receives two face-down playing cards – with the Button player first to act preflop.

Those who continued in the hand will see the flop, three neighborhood playing cards which are placed face-up on the desk. Next is the turn, one additional face-up group card with the third spherical of betting. The hand wraps up with the river, a ultimate face-up group card. After this last round of betting, the participant who made one of the best five-card poker hand between the 5 community playing cards and the two hole playing cards wins the hand. No-limit hold ’em has grown in popularity and is the shape mostly found in televised match poker and is the sport performed in the main event of the World Series of Poker. In no-limit maintain ’em, gamers might bet or elevate any amount over the minimum raise as a lot as all the chips the player has at the table (called an all-in bet). The minimum elevate is equal to the scale of the previous bet or elevate.

In any betting spherical, the hand ends when one participant bets or raises, and all other players fold. The participant seated directly to the left of the button is the small blind, and the participant to the left of the small blind is the large blind. Both of those players must put in a pressured bet (hence ‘blind’) earlier than the hand is dealt. The worth of the small blind is always half (or close to half) of the price of the large blind.

Exposed playing cards are handled on a situational foundation, as stated in the guidelines of the particular variation of poker. When a card is exposed by the fault of the dealer, the foundations of the sport apply, and the player does not get a say in preserving or rejecting the card. Any card proven to one or more different gamers by the vendor is taken into account an exposed card, as is any card that is dealt off the desk. However, if a card is unintentionally exposed by the player, they must still be played.

When wagering takes place in the last spherical, the final participant to guess or increase would be the first to show their cards. When a player holds a hand that’s likely the winner, they should show that hand instantly to speed play. When a aspect pot is involved, those enjoying in that pot should present their playing cards before those that are only concerned in the primary pot.
